Xcode6(Swift)にて、60進法を利用したカウントダウンの作成の手順
60進法を利用したカウントダウンを作りたいのですが、以下のコードだと
「2分」ではなく、「120秒」として表示されてしまいます。
import UIKit
class ViewController: UIViewController {
//最初に表示されるスタート地点の数字
var timerCount = 120
var timer = NSTimer()
@IBOutlet weak var myLabel: UILabel!
func Counting(){
timerCount -= 1
myLabel.text = "\(timerCount)"
}
override func viewDidLoad() {
super.viewDidLoad()
// Do any additional setup after loading the view, typically from a nib.
timer = NSTimer.scheduledTimerWithTimeInterval(1, target: self, selector: Selector("Counting"), userInfo: nil, repeats: true)
}
override func didReceiveMemoryWarning() {
super.didReceiveMemoryWarning()
// Dispose of any resources that can be recreated.
}
}
ビルドしたらすぐにカウントダウンが始まるという設定なのですが、
60進法を利用した書き方が分かりません。
お詳しい方がいましたら、ご回答どうか宜しくお願い致します。